Key Insights
The Asia Pacific functional beverage market, valued at $98.53 billion in 2025, is projected to experience robust growth, driven by increasing health consciousness, rising disposable incomes, and a growing preference for convenient, nutritious options. Key product segments include energy drinks, sports drinks, fortified juices, dairy and dairy alternative beverages, and others. The market's expansion is fueled by the increasing popularity of health and wellness trends, particularly among younger demographics, leading to higher demand for beverages offering added functional benefits like enhanced energy, improved immunity, or specific nutritional advantages. Distribution channels are diverse, encompassing supermarkets/hypermarkets, pharmacies/drug stores, convenience stores, and online retail stores, with online sales experiencing significant growth. Leading players like Vitasoy, PepsiCo, Otsuka, Suntory, Keurig Dr Pepper, Red Bull, Danone, Coca-Cola, Fonterra, and Nestlé are actively shaping market dynamics through product innovation, strategic partnerships, and aggressive marketing campaigns. The significant presence of these multinational corporations underlines the market's substantial potential and competitive landscape.
Within the Asia Pacific region, China, Japan, India, South Korea, and Australia represent major markets, each with unique consumer preferences and market characteristics. The projected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 8.33% from 2025 to 2033 suggests a continuous expansion, potentially influenced by factors like rising urbanization, changing lifestyles, and increased awareness of the benefits of functional beverages. However, challenges such as fluctuating raw material prices, stringent regulatory standards, and increasing competition could influence the market's trajectory. Nevertheless, the overall outlook for the Asia Pacific functional beverage market remains positive, indicating significant growth opportunities for existing and new market entrants in the coming years. Specific regional differences in growth rates are likely to be influenced by factors such as per capita income, health awareness campaigns, and existing regulatory frameworks.

Notable Milestones in Asia Pacific Functional Beverages Industry Sector
- February 2022: Nestlé launched plant-based Milo in Thailand, tapping into the growing demand for vegan options.
- February 2022: Red Bull India launched a limited-edition watermelon-flavored energy drink, driving innovation and appealing to consumer preferences.
- August 2022: Coca-Cola India introduced Limca Sportz, an electrolyte-based sports drink targeting the expanding fitness market.
